Abstract
An enhanced handoff signaling method is disclosed that provides a short negotiation time by avoiding the need to downgrade and upgrade, provides greater efficiency by preventing calls from being dropped due to unsuccessful negotiation after the mobile station has moved to the target system, and minimizes the signaling load on the spectrum during handoff negotiations. The method includes the steps of negotiating air interface attributes that the target system can grant, sending a single message to the mobile station to order the mobile station to execute a handoff and to convey granted air interface attributes to the mobile station and executing a handoff of the mobile station to channels on the target system in accordance with the granted air interface attributes. Accordingly, a channel is not dropped even when the target system supports air interface attributes different from the source system. Further, the negotiating is performed solely over wireline links between the source system and the target system, and no negotiation involving the mobile station is required.
